Detail 01
Sits inside the bell on a cork, sealing it completely. All air exits through the stem tube.
Detail 02
Stem out gives the thin, distant wah sound. Stem in and cupped by hand gives the classic vocal effect.
Detail 03
Held by friction alone, not clips. Fit varies with bell taper, so seating depth differs between horns.
Detail 04
Sized for Bb trumpet bells. It will not seat correctly in a flugelhorn or a trombone.
Detail 05
Mid-range for a stem mute. Above stamped student mutes, below custom hand-spun models.

No. It is sized for Bb trumpet bells. A flugelhorn's wider, faster bell taper will not seat it correctly.
Yes. Stem out is the standard jazz setting and gives the thin, buzzy, distant tone. Stem in produces a fuller sound.
It reduces volume noticeably, but it is a performance mute, not a practice mute. A dedicated practice mute is far quieter.
It is held by cork friction. A properly seated mute stays put, but the cork can loosen with use and may need replacing.
